    Great city with beautiful parks and museums and places of interest. Not a huge city by China standards, but this makes it easier to explore. All the modern shopping areas are there, Wanda Mall, cinema, numerous places to eat and some fantastic street food. Well worth a visit.

    Quanzhou has great history & interesting cultural influences, meaning there are amazing history, architectural, and religious things to explore all over. It is also a very active city, and I love finding alleys, markets, and locals around corners and small areas. Plenty of surrounding mountains & parks if you want to get out of the busy parts too. Definitely worth a few days, although can see highlights in a day or two if pressed for time. I have returned quite a few times over years.
